在近年来,随着区块链技术的迅猛发展,以太坊作为一种主要的智能合约平台,吸引了大量用户和开发者的关注。对于普通用户而言,使用以太坊钱包进行日常交易和管理资产的需求日益增加。然而,钱包的用户界面(UI)设计却往往成为用户体验的一大挑战。本文将探讨如何设计一个用户友好的以太坊钱包UI,并深入分析其最佳实践与面临的常见挑战。
设计一款成功的以太坊钱包需要遵循一些基本原则和最佳实践,旨在提升用户体验。以下是几个关键要素:
用户界面的复杂性往往会导致用户流失。设计者应确保界面简洁,方便用户快速找到所需功能。主屏幕可以显示用户的资产总览,包括账户余额、最近交易和快速发送/接收按钮。
用户应能够清楚了解如何在钱包应用中导航。使用清晰的标签和图标,设计干净的导航栏可以有效引导用户。同时,遵循一致性原则是设计成功的关键,用户在不同功能间切换时应感到自然流畅。
考虑到用户使用以太坊钱包的设备多种多样,设计时应确保界面在桌面应用和移动端均能良好适配。响应式设计不仅能提升用户体验,还有助于增加用户的粘性。
在交易过程中,用户需要及时的反馈以确认操作的成功与否。设计者应在每个重要的操作后提供明确的信息,如“交易成功”、“余额更新”等,以减少用户的不安感。
安全性是用户最关心的问题之一。UI设计应强调钱包的安全建议,如启用双因素认证(2FA)的选项、强密码创建提示等。这不仅可以增强用户的信任感,还能有效降低安全风险。
虽然设计一个优秀的以太坊钱包UI有许多最佳实践,但仍然存在一系列的挑战。下面我们将探讨这些挑战及其可能的解决方案。
许多用户对区块链技术和加密钱包不够了解,导致他们在使用钱包时感到困惑。设计者需要提供清晰的帮助文档和引导程序,以教育用户有关如何安全地存储和发送加密货币的信息。这可以通过集成常见问题解答(FAQ)部分或在线聊天支持来实现。
以太坊网络的交易费用经常波动,这个复杂性可能会令用户感到误解或恐惧。设计者需要在UI中清晰地展示当前的交易费用,并提供发送时“快速”、“正常”、“经济”等不同费用选项的解释。允许用户根据自身需求选择合适的交易速度,也会增加他们的满意度。
市场上有多种类型的钱包,例如冷钱包、热钱包、硬件钱包等。设计者应在UI中适当引导用户理解不同钱包的优缺点,并帮助他们选择合适的选项。这可以通过信息图示或简单的比较表来呈现,让用户做出明智的选择。
许多用户并不仅仅使用以太坊,他们可能还在其他区块链上持有资产。设计者应考虑到多币种支持的需求,并在UI中提供方便的管理界面,让用户轻松查看和转移各类资产。此外,还应注意各种资产的转换率和价格实时更新,以帮助用户做出及时的决策。
选择一个安全的以太坊钱包是确保数字资产安全的首要步骤。首先,用户应考虑钱包的类型:热钱包(在线钱包)和冷钱包(离线钱包)各有优劣。热钱包使用方便,但相对安全性较低,因为它们易受网络攻击;冷钱包则安全性较高,适合长期储存资产。其次,用户需要查看钱包的安全特性,如是否支持双因素认证、私钥管理方式等。此外,查看其他用户的评论和评分也是选择安全钱包的有效方法。良好的社区声誉和持续的技术更新表示钱包厂商对用户资产的重视。
以太坊网络的高负荷可能导致交易确认时间延长。用户在发送交易时需要关注当时的网络拥堵情况以及交易费用。交易费用越高,矿工越愿意尽快打包这笔交易。若用户支付的费用低于市场均价,矿工可能会选择优先处理高费用的交易。此外,某些情况下,用户可能设置了错误的交易参数,比如 nonce(交易的序列号)出错,也可能导致交易停滞。此时,可以尝试取消并重新发送交易,或者等待网络恢复正常。
备份以太坊钱包非常重要,确保用户在设备丢失或故障时能恢复资产。一般来说,用户需要导出其私钥或助记词,并安全地存储在离线环境中。私钥是访问数字资产的唯一凭证,需妥善保管。在使用软件钱包时,用户通常可以在设置中找到备份选项,并能够导出必要的备份文件。在选用硬件钱包时,提供的恢复助记词也应妥善保存,切忌将私钥或助记词保存在不安全的地方,如邮箱或云存储服务。
以太坊交易的手续费(Gas Fees)是发送交易或执行合约时支付给矿工的费用。这一费用依赖于网络的拥堵程度和用户选择的 Gas 价格。Gas 价格一般以 Gwei(1 Gwei = 1,000,000,000 wei)计量,用户在发送交易时需要设定 Gas 限制和 Gas 价格。Gas 限制是指用户愿意为交易消耗的最大 Gas 量,而 Gas 价格则影响该交易被矿工处理的优先级。通过观察市场实时数据,用户可做出合理的费用设置,确保交易及时确认。
随着以太坊及其生态系统的日益扩大,设计出一个用户友好的钱包UI变得尤为重要。通过遵循最佳实践和不断克服行业挑战,设计者们既能提升使用体验,也能为用户提供安全和便利。面对诸多常见问题,用户应不断学习并提高其对加密资产管理的理解,减少操作中的错误和风险。最终,设计一个成功的以太坊钱包UI需要多方面的考虑,安全性和用户体验的平衡是关键所在。